Adeniran joins race for PDP c/manship

- By Saawua Terzungwe

A former minister of education, Professor Tunde Adeniran, has joined the race for the national chairmansh­ip of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), saying that he will reclaim the party’s national glory.

He urged the delegates for the Port Harcourt scheduled convention to entrust him with the responsibi­lity of leading the party.

Adeniran, who spoke through his media aide, Yemi Akinbode, said that the task ahead of the PDP and Nigeria required “fortitude and experience to help the party achieve its objectives.”

He said that as a founding member of the PDP who has served in its various frontline capacities, if elected as chairman, he would deploy his wealth of experience in serving the party and the country.
